What is 737.MSVCR80.dll?

Dynamic Link Library (DLL) files are important components of Windows operating systems. They contain code and data that can be used by multiple programs at the same time, helping to conserve memory and simplify system management. The specific file 737.MSVCR80.dll is part of the Microsoft Visual C++ runtime library, which provides essential functions for running programs developed with Microsoft Visual C++.

In the context of Windows Embedded, 737.MSVCR80.dll plays a crucial role in ensuring that the operating system and related applications function smoothly. It provides necessary resources and functions for software developed or configured for Windows Embedded, contributing to the overall performance and reliability of the system. Without 737.MSVCR80.dll and other related DLL files, many programs and features within Windows Embedded may not work as intended.

Although essential for system performance, dynamic Link Library (DLL) files can occasionally cause specific errors. The following enumerates some of the most common DLL errors users encounter while operating their systems:

  • 737.MSVCR80.dll Access Violation: This points to a situation where a process has attempted to interact with 737.MSVCR80.dll in a way that violates system or application rules. This might be due to incorrect programming, memory overflows, or the running process lacking necessary permissions.
  • Cannot register 737.MSVCR80.dll: This suggests that the DLL file could not be registered by the system, possibly due to inconsistencies or errors in the Windows Registry. Another reason might be that the DLL file is not in the correct directory or is missing.
  • 737.MSVCR80.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This message indicates that the DLL file is either not compatible with your Windows version or has an internal problem. It could be due to a programming error in the DLL, or an attempt to use a DLL from a different version of Windows.
  • 737.MSVCR80.dll not found: The required DLL file is absent from the expected directory. This can result from software uninstalls, updates, or system changes that mistakenly remove or relocate DLL files.
  • This application failed to start because 737.MSVCR80.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This error occurs when an application tries to access a DLL file that doesn't exist in the system. Reinstalling the application can restore the missing DLL file if it was included in the original software package.

Run the Windows Check Disk Utility

Run the Windows Check Disk Utility Thumbnail

Step 1: Open the Command Prompt

Step 1: Open the Command Prompt Thumbnail
  1. Press the Windows key.

  2. Type Command Prompt in the search bar and press Enter.

  3.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.

Step 2: Run Check Disk Utility

Step 2: Run Check Disk Utility Thumbnail
  1. In the Command Prompt window, type chkdsk /f and press Enter.

  2. If the system reports that it cannot run the check because the disk is in use, type Y and press Enter to schedule the check for the next system restart.

Step 3: Restart Your Computer

Step 3: Restart Your Computer Thumbnail
  1. If you had to schedule the check, restart your computer for the check to be performed.

Step 4: Check if the Problem is Solved

Step 4: Check if the Problem is Solved Thumbnail
  1. After the check (and restart, if necessary), check if the 737.MSVCR80.dll problem persists.
